I am having the same problem on my work system. Ntbackup initializes but
immediately fails, the file to be written shows 2k file size. This is the
same no matter what external drive is chosen. This error is only on backing
up the local system. Ntbackup works fine when backing up a system across the
network, I do that on my server daily and on a weekly master. I have a
feeling it is in the security settings which XPSP2 ramps up, I have tried to
adjust the firewall to allow Ntbackup as an exception but same failure. I
have also tried adjusting the rights for the drive under manage to allow my
user under all situations but still same error.
